Bio
Vildhjarta is Swedish Progressive Metal band, formed in Hudiksvall in 2005. Their sound draws on the influences which were quite present in metal at the time: staccato riffs on low tuned guitars, atmospheric soundscapes, backbeat driven grooves despite odd time signatures, guttural vocals. Reminiscent of the sub-genre, djent, stylized and popularized by the band, Meshuggah; but finding their own niche with a depth of imagery, rhythmic complexity, and more of a nod to themes of bleakness, loss, despair, and nature. The group debuted with the 2009 two song EP, Omnislash; before signing to Century Media in 2011. Shortly afterwards, they released their debut album, Maastaden, which received positive reviews. Maastaden tells the story of a hidden town, and it’s many trials and tribulations. Their most recent album, Maastaden Under Vatten, revisits the fictional town of their debut album; with many of the same lyrical themes coming up, but the musical composition continues to mature and grow in intensity. Fans have speculated whether the sound is hinting at their continued evolution.
